13-305. Cities, villages, school districts, and counties; joint facilities; powers.

For the specific purposes set forth in section 13-304, any city, village, school district or county shall have the power to receive (1) any grant or devise of real estate, (2) any grant or gift or bequest of money or other personal property, and (3) any other donation in trust or otherwise.

Source
    Laws 1963, c. 481, § 2, p. 1550;
    R.S.1943, (1983), § 23-821.

Annotations City may acquire real estate for park purposes by gift. Bowley v. City of Omaha, 181 Neb. 515, 149 N.W.2d 417 (1967).
